Coolant leaking from primary weep hole

2004 CHRYSLER SEBRING
150,000 MILES • 2.7L • 6 CYL • 2WD • AUTOMATIC

Replaced water pump and thermostat. put all together. went to add coolant in over flow tank and instantly once it reached cold mark on tank it started pouring out of weep hole next to thermostat housing. why is this? Please help! Thanks

I think this a coolant bleed valve. Ensure that the bleed valve is tightened and refill. I have included a component diagram down below in the diagrams to make sure we are talking about the same thing.
